I replaced the sending unit because it was reading bad, and the first replacement one broke when the mechanic put it in. Was a couple of weeks before I could get back there to have them swap it out. Not fun, driving an old truck with no functional oil pressure gauge!
I had noticed that it was leaking at the back of the engine, and it was suggested that the sending unit might be the cause of the leak. Around that time it started reading more erratically too.

The low oil pressure when warm, is apparently a thing on older Vortec engines. As long as it doesn't use oil or make noise, it's not bad....
